Green Beans With Lemon
- Total Time
- 15 minutes

Ingredients
Yield:4 servings
- 1pound green beans, trimmed and cut into 2-inch lengths
- Salt to taste
- 2tablespoons butter at room temperature
- Juice of ½ lemon
- 2tablespoons finely chopped parsley
- Freshly ground pepper to taste
Preparation
- Step 1
Rinse the beans and drain them. Put them into a saucepan with water to cover and salt.
- Step 2
Bring to a boil and simmer 10 minutes or until tender. The beans must remain a trifle firm or al dente.
- Step 3
Drain the beans and return them to a hot saucepan. Add the butter and sprinkle with lemon juice, parsley and pepper. Toss and serve hot.
